| // Tests migrating the value of the deprecated Autofill master pref to the new |
| // prefs and that this operation takes place only once. |
| TEST_F(AutofillPrefsTest, MigrateDeprecatedAutofillPrefs) { |
| // All prefs should be enabled by default. |
| ASSERT_TRUE(pref_service()->GetBoolean(kAutofillEnabledDeprecated)); |
| ASSERT_TRUE(pref_service()->GetBoolean(kAutofillProfileEnabled)); |
| ASSERT_TRUE(pref_service()->GetBoolean(kAutofillCreditCardEnabled)); |
| |
| // Disable the deprecated master pref and make sure the new fine-grained prefs |
| // are not affected by that. |
| pref_service()->SetBoolean(kAutofillEnabledDeprecated, false);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illEnabledDeprecated)); |
| EXPECT_TRUE(pref_service()->GetBoolean(kAutofillProfileEnabled)); |
| EXPECT_TRUE(pref_service()->GetBoolean(kAutofillCreditCardEnabled)); |
| |
| // Migrate the deprecated master pref's value to the new fine-grained prefs. |
| // Their values should become the same as the deprecated master pref's value. |
| MigrateDeprecatedAutofillPrefs(pref_service());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illProfileEnabled));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illCreditCardEnabled)); |
| |
| // Enable the deprecated master pref and make sure the new fine-grained prefs |
| // are not affected by that. |
| pref_service()->SetBoolean(kAutofillEnabledDeprecated, true); |
| EXPECT_TRUE(pref_service()->GetBoolean(kAutofillEnabledDeprecated));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illProfileEnabled));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illCreditCardEnabled)); |
| |
| // Migrate the deprecated master pref's value to the new fine-grained prefs. |
| // Their values should not be affected when migration happens a second time. |
| MigrateDeprecatedAutofillPrefs(pref_service());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illProfileEnabled)); |
| EXPECT_FALSE(pref_service()->GetBoolean(kAutofillCreditCardEnabled)); |
| } |
